My Life Dovetailed
This is one of Darski's free patterns found here that I often revisit. It has a nice historical look to it and it works up fairly quickly and easily. The shoes come from Sweet Silver Creations School Girl Uniform available for purchase here. I wanted a strapless shoe for this outfit and this fit the need. I added an extra row to the shoe reducing the front of the shoe with an additional 4 sc decreases.
I followed the suggested hook sizes. I chose not to use elastic and did a sc 4 then decrease around waist to make the waist a bit smaller. It worked well for me to keep the skirt from sliding down.
This dress was made with Caron One Pound , Medium Grey and White using the left over Red Heart Super Saver Yarn, Petal Pink from making the last baby doll carrier.
